Haiti - Justice : Warning to receivers...
Jean Renel Sanon, the Minister of Justice and Public Security (MJSP), in a reminder note, dated Thursday, April 17, said found with amazement that despite the wanted persons notice that some offenders are subject, some people take the risk to help them.

The Ministry of Justice, reminds them that such behavior is punishable by Haitian criminal law and promised that the houses involved in acts of receiving (actes de recel) will be sealed and the vehicles seized.

Reminder note of Minister Sanon :

"Port-au-Prince April 17, 2014

Reminder note

The Ministry of Justice and Public Security (MJSP), noted with amazement that despite the wanted persons notice that some offenders are subject, individuals with bad intentions take the risk to accommodate them in their home, either in bad faith or ignorance or irresponsibility. They even dare to transport them onboard their vehicles from one point to another.

MJSP reminds them that such behavior makes them accomplices likely to be prosecuted with the utmost rigor for harboring criminals (recel de malfaiteurs) and in accordance with the provisions of the Haitian Penal Code.

Seal will be put on all the houses involved and vehicles used for transportation will also be seized.

So that no one ignore or pretext the ignorance, the MSPJ believes appropriate to recall that the Haitian law identifies as 'receivers' (receleur) anyone who amuses himself by hide criminals from justice and the police, who offers his house as a place of accommodation to fugitive offenders or who transports people fleeing the police or the mandates of judges.

While inviting citizens to cooperate with the law, the Ministry of Justice and Public Security reaffirms its determination to fight against crime and, in all its forms.

Jean Renel Sanon
Minister"
